- [ ] Off-site run: loaned exhibition pieces. Collect the two bronze maquettes on loan from the Ostrevan Gallery, verify seal numbers against the loan register, and pack in crate B with desiccant packs. Condition photos must be filed before departure from the Kelbourne store. The courier hand-over instruction is appended below for reference.

dispatch memo: the ulaox normir courier leaves the praath ledger at gate 9753 under passcode 639705

## Account Recovery — Trailnote Offline Mode

When a surveyor's Trailnote app has been offline for 30+ days, their local credentials expire and sync refuses to resume. Don't make them wipe the device — all their unsynced field data lives there! Instead, open the support console, pick "Offline Reinstate," and enter their handle. The console will ask for the support team's shared recovery passphrase before issuing a reinstatement token. Use the one below.

unlock words, bagaf-fajeg: zorael-kelax-fraath-quenix-eliok-sileth-aldmir-wenir-druiel

Q3 Planning Note — Finance

Verratex will open operations in the Kelmar Basin region in Q3. Capex estimate: 1.4M, staged over two quarters. Hiring freeze elsewhere funds the first wave. Expect customs and logistics overhead above baseline for six months. Margin drag forecast at 2.1 points, recovering by Q1. Hold contingency at 8%. Full model ships Friday. Confidential planning detail follows below.

internal memo for yahaf-hawif: The finance team signed off on a budget of $59.9 million for Project Rusax.

## Deployment

Proselint-Q ships as a single static binary. Deploy by pushing a tagged release; the Wrenmoor pipeline builds, signs, and rolls it to the lint fleet. No database, no migrations.

Rollbacks: re-tag the previous release and re-run the pipeline. Canary runs against the Bellholt docs corpus before full rollout; a canary failure blocks promotion automatically.

Reviewers should confirm any config changes match the deployed environment. The configuration the service runs with in production is shown below.

deployment values, yadug-bawif:
[framir]
team = pelox
access_code = ac_a38ab2
owner = tamion.julael
host = framir.tolvaqlabs.test
port = 11211
peer = tammir.zemvargrid.local
salt = 2215ef03
pin = 1541